star this property question text To ask the Secretary of State for Defence, what assessment his Department has made of the implications for its policies of reports that British officials are being targeted for recruitment by hostile states using online recruitment platforms. more like this

star this property answer text <p>We aim, through our Personnel Security Strategy, to continuously build a security conscious organisation where staff understand the spectrum of evolving threats, including the potential to be targeted for recruitment by hostile states using online recruitment platforms. We take our responsibilities in this area seriously, and leverage a variety of methods to keep the Department and its people safe, and to fulfil our mission to safeguard national security. These include delivering security training, maintaining a strong internal security culture, recognising signs of people risk through comprehensive oversight, and delivering a range of support and guidance to staff to keep them aware of the latest threats. Moreover, the Department makes use of specific cross-HMG programmes such as 'Think Before You link' https://www.cpni.gov.uk/security-campaigns/think-you-link and has introduced a Cyber Confident programme to improve awareness of the Cyber threat, to help personnel spot potential targeting from hostile states and act appropriately if this occurs.</p>

star this property question text To ask the Secretary of State for Defence, what steps he plans to take to commemorate the 80th anniversary of D-Day. more like this

star this property answer text <p>The Ministry of Defence is working across Whitehall and with external stakeholders to put together an appropriate programme of events to mark the important occasion of the 80<sup>th</sup> anniversary of D-Day in the UK and in France.</p><p> </p><p>The UK’s National Commemorative Event in Portsmouth will once again highlight this nation’s major contribution as a leading partner in the Western Alliance. The UK’s main commemorative event in France will take place at the British Normandy Memorial at Ver-sur-Mer overlooking GOLD beach. It is the first time, during a major commemorative year, that this event will take place at the memorial following its official opening in 2021.</p> more like this

star this property question text To ask the Secretary of State for Defence, what steps he has taken to (a) maintain and (b) improve amphibious assault capabilities. more like this

star this property answer text <p>The Commando Force modernisation programme is delivering a fundamental change to the UK's amphibious capabilities. The programme will be delivered in two investment increments, called OPERATE and FIGHT. OPERATE will deliver a transformation of 3 Commando Brigade's operational capability on land while FIGHT will deliver the additional capabilities required to conduct ship-to-shore operations in a contested maritime environment.</p><p>On current plans, the Landing Platform Docks, HMS Albion and HMS Bulwark, will retire from service by the end of 2034. As part of the transformation of our Commando Forces, options for future amphibious capability are being developed in the form of the Multi Role Support Ship (MRSS).</p><p>The Secretary of State has also commissioned a plan on how the Royal Marines excellent work and capabilities can be bolstered and enhanced to protect Britain from a world that has grown more dangerous. An update to the House will be provided in due course.</p> more like this

star this property question text To ask the Secretary of State for Defence, whether his Department plans to take steps to provide naval patrols around Taiwan. more like this

star this property answer text <p>The UK is committed to asserting its rights to freedom of navigation and overflight, as laid out in the United Nations Convention on the Law of the Sea. Wherever we operate in the world we do so in full compliance with international laws and norms. The last transit through the Taiwan Strait was carried out by the Royal Navy in 2021, when HMS Richmond (Type 23 Frigate) conducted a Taiwan Strait Navigation during CSG21 deployment en route to Vietnam.</p> more like this

star this property question text To ask the Secretary of State for Defence, what steps his Department is taking to protect (a) water plants, (b) power plants and (c) other critical national infrastructure. more like this

star this property answer text <p>Within the UK, the safety and security of individual pieces of critical national infrastructure is the responsibility of the relevant commercial operator and Police force for the geographical area in which it is located. At the strategic level, the department for Business, Energy, and Industrial Strategy (BEIS) is responsible for the overall operation and resilience of the UK's domestic energy sector. The Department for the Environment, Food and Rural Affairs (DEFRA) is responsible for the overall operation and resilience of the UK's water sector. The Centre for the Protection of National Infrastructure (CPNI) provides advice on the resilience of Critical National Infrastructure across the UK.</p><p>The Ministry of Defence and the UK Armed Forces are responsible for the security and territorial integrity of the UK as a whole. Defence of the UK and its overseas territories from the malicious intent of our adversaries is the first task of the Ministry of Defence and our Armed Forces. This extends to being prepared to defend against and counter external hostile threats to our way of life and the delivery of critical services. I would, however, like to reassure you that I have received no indication that the Armed Forces would be required to provide protection water plants, power plants, or to other critical national infrastructure in the foreseeable future.</p>
